How many miles per gallon does a Land Cruiser get?
Toyota says the 2024 Land Cruiser has an EPA combined fuel economy rating of 23 mpg. The city rating is 22 mpg and the highway rating is 25 mpg, and that applies to all three trim levels with the 2.4-liter turbo-four hybrid powertrain.
What is the difference between 2024 and 2025 Land Cruiser?
The 2025 Toyota Land Cruiser, as you might expect, is pretty much the same as the new-for-2024 250-series version, but it gets new pricing and loses the first-year-only First Edition trim level, leaving only the entry-level Land Cruiser 1958 and the nameless, formerly mid-grade Land Cruiser behind.

What is the gas mileage on a 2025 Land Cruiser?
The Land Cruiser's EPA ratings sit at 23 mpg combined, 22 mpg city, and 25 mpg highway. Those numbers are significantly better than what the previous-generation V-8 model offered. In our real-world 75-mph highway fuel-economy test, the Land Cruiser First Edition underperformed, achieving 21 mpg.
